As digital demands intensify across Asia-Pacific, enterprises are rethinking cloud strategies to support long-term scalability, agility, and AI-driven innovation. Cloud modernisation is viewing not as a one-time migration, but as a strategic rearchitecture effort tailored to evolving business needs. With regional cloud spending projected to reach USD 250 billion in 2025, over 50% of APAC enterprises are expecting to modernise half of their cloud infrastructure by 2027.
Driven by the adoption of AI, machine learning, and real-time data personalisation, organisations are moving toward hybrid cloud models that balance innovation with operational control. Singapore’s S$150 million Enterprise Compute Initiative exemplifies national support for SMEs embracing AI as part of their transformation journey.
Key takeaways include:
- Cloud-first is not cloud-only: Enterprises are opting for hybrid setups that maintain governance while enabling innovation.
- Sector-specific challenges persist: Finance, healthcare, and public sectors face scaling issues due to legacy systems, fragmented data, and rising compliance demands.
- Siloed infrastructures hinder performance: In sectors like healthcare, outdated systems result in poor integration, limiting data visibility and efficiency.
To overcome these challenges, experts recommend a phased modernisation approach, supported by platform-consistent architecture and reusable components such as shared tools and rule engines. This fosters scalable integration without increasing system complexity.
Intentional modernisation also requires organisations to align cloud architecture with value delivery across channels and functions. Planning should not be treated as a technical afterthought, but as a strategic enabler of digital success. Crucially, stakeholder engagement-from IT teams to business units-must be prioritised early in the transformation journey.
In a climate of rapid technological advancement and rising AI integration, sustainable cloud architecture will serve as the foundation for adaptable, compliant, and high-performing enterprise ecosystems across the APAC region.
